Septolete Total lollipops are indicated for the symptomatic treatment of throat and oral cavity infections (pharyngitis, laryngitis, gingivitis, conditions before and after tooth extraction, etc.).

Composition

Active ingredients: benzydamine hydrochloride, cetylpyridinium chloride;

1 lollipop contains 3 mg of benzydamine hydrochloride and 1 mg of cetylpyridinium chloride;

Excipients: eucalyptus oil, levomenthol, sucralose, citric acid, isomalt (type M), diamond blue FCF (E 133).

Contraindication

Hypersensitivity to the active substances or to any of the excipients.

Age up to 6 years.

Method of application

You should slowly dissolve the lollipop in your mouth.

For optimal results, do not suck on the lollipop immediately before or after brushing your teeth.

Overdose

Toxic manifestations of benzydamine overdose include agitation, convulsions, sweating, ataxia, tremors, and vomiting.

Signs and symptoms of intoxication after taking significant doses of cetylpyridinium chloride are nausea, vomiting, shortness of breath, cyanosis, asphyxia due to paralysis of the respiratory muscles, CNS depression, hypotension and coma. The lethal dose for humans is approximately 1-3 g (which exceeds the maximum daily dose of Septolete Total lozenges by 250-750 times).

Since there is no specific antidote, treatment of acute overdose is symptomatic.

Side effects

Immune system disorders: hypersensitivity reactions.

Respiratory system: bronchospasm.

Gastrointestinal: burning sensation in the mouth, dry mouth.

Skin and subcutaneous tissue disorders: urticaria, photosensitivity.

Interaction

Septolete Total should not be used simultaneously with other antiseptics.

Lozenges should not be sucked with milk due to its ability to reduce the antiseptic activity of cetylpyridinium chloride.

Storage conditions

The medicinal product does not require any special storage conditions.

Store in the original packaging to protect from light.

Keep out of reach of children.

Shelf life – 3 years.
